Origins and Family
Ang Chan II was born in Phnom Penh[2]. He was born on +1791-01-01T00:00:00Z[3]. His father was Ang Eng[8]. His mother was Moneang Aut[9].
Career and Affiliations
Ang Chan II worked as a king[6]. He held the position of King of Cambodia[12].
Personal Life
A child of Ang Chan II was Ang Mey[10]. His religion is recorded as Buddhism[13].
Death and Burial
Ang Chan II died on +1834-12-01T00:00:00Z[5]. He died in Udong[4].
